Utility and meter seals are specialized hardware designed for precision auditing. In the automotive world, these high-security twist seals are gaining popularity for protecting ELDs, diagnostic ports, and sensitive electronic controllers.
Twist-Style Locking Mechanisms
Unlike standard pull-tight seals, twist seals use a rotating internal mechanism that anchors a stainless steel or copper wire. Once the handle is snapped off, the seal cannot be unwound without destroying the polycarbonate body.

The Automotive Connection
Why use meter seals in car shipping? The rise of connected vehicles means data integrity is just as important as physical integrity.
| Location | Why Seal It? | Recommended Seal |
|---|---|---|
| OBD-II Port | Prevent mileage or software tampering | Polycarbonate Twist |
| ELD Units | Ensure regulatory data logging | Twist Seal w/ Wire |
| Battery Terminals | Prevent unauthorized power cycles | Custom Wire Seal |

FAQs About Auto Transport
A twist seal uses a rotating mechanism to anchor a sealing wire inside a polycarbonate body, providing clear evidence if anyone attempts to tamper with it.
We use high-security meter seals to protect ELD (Electronic Logging Device) units and diagnostic ports in trucks to ensure data integrity during transport.
Polycarbonate is transparent and impact-resistant, allowing for easy visual inspection of the internal locking mechanism for any signs of tampering.
No, meter seals are designed for one-time use. Once the wire is cut or the body is damaged, it cannot be resealed without leaving obvious evidence.
